Trey: European Redemption (Russian Mob Chronicles Book 7) by Shandi Boyes – Review by Faith Jackson

Trey: European Redemption (Russian Mob Chronicles Book 7)Trey: European Redemption by Shandi Boyes
My rating: 5 of 5 stars

This book is one of the grittiest I’ve read in awhile. I didn’t enjoy how graphic Kristina’s life was prior to meeting Trey but at least she kept a decent head on her shoulders to move away from all of the pain she endured. I love the way they not only loved one another but sought out to heal one another’s wounds after a worse past that could’ve taken the both of them down but in different ways. This is a sweet book about resilience, determination and the sweetest love that one can experience. We have to remember the characters are also human but as we all are, they are also flawed but in the best ways possible.
